Top 3 Root Causes of Headaches, Neck Pain and Jaw Pain

Top 3 Root Causes of Headaches, Neck Pain and Jaw Pain


Tense, stiff, achy…. feels like there is a saran wrap constantly stifling my neck, my back or my head. Rest, ice packs, heat, stretching, pain pills, injections and surgery can help remedy symptoms but sooner or later, the symptoms will come back if you do not address the “WHY it hurts”.  

  1. Tension, stiffness, achiness… are ways your body is talking to you. It is a language of postural  imbalance which is the first of the underlying causes. There are parts of our body which are often overused or underused. We wrongly position our body parts or bones that our muscles compensate or cannot function the way they are designed and thus, pain ensues. 
  2. Another cause is the habits we have developed over time. Habits have become deeply embedded in our brain that they are felt as normal in our lives.  Clenching, mouth breathing, grinding teeth or chewing your lips are common habits and are very hard to break. If you want to change a habit, you have to give the body a new one to adopt for change to happen. 
  3. Stress is a part of life.  Oftentimes, stress is so deeply ingrained in the body that you no longer recognize the signals. We attribute stress as worry, fear and negative thoughts or experiences and when we don’t feel that way, we don’t think we are stressed. Stress can be in the body manifesting as pain, spasms, stiffness, anxiety, gut issues and most commonly experienced by grinding or clenching our teeth.
